How to : Avoid The USED CAR Scam

    • 1). RED FLAG....RED FLAG!
      Many car buyers are falling victim to the scams that caused many homeowners to start living in a tent. Most of the time, this used car scam is used on the poor or working class Americans whose biggest purchase (other than a home) will be a car.....used or new.

    • 2). Here's how it works. The dealer needlessly complicates and confuses the buyer unnecessarily which enables them to charge excessive prices and fees for the car AND the financing. Buyers with bad or marginal credit are the biggest victims in this "yo-yo" sales practice. In many cases, the dealer would send you off the lot with a smile and wave goodbye, then, days later, call you to say the financing couldn't be arranged at the original terms.

    • 3). The consumer is told he/she must come back and sign NEW papers at a higher interest rate and other unfavorable terms. Should they try to cancel, the dealer tells them: NO WAY! Often the customer is in no position to refuse. These practices are troubling and may indicate criminal fraud so says the FTC, and they are pressing forward to put a stop to it.
